The sixth and final part of our special series for the summer in which Spencer Leigh explores the 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 archives in Caversham to explore how the country and the 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 responded to shifts in popular culture between 1950 and 1980.

In "The Awkward Squad" he tells all about the people who didn't play by the rules... including Gilbert Harding, Bernard Levin, Spike Milligan and Fritz Spiegl.

When Frank Sinatra came to the UK in 1953, he was scheduled to appear with Cyril Stapleton's Showband, but demanded to be on the cover of the Radio Times - in Coronation week! Find out what happened...
